Conveniently, my father is a fan of neat little phrases that promote discipline and hard work.  Two essentials for a productive creative life.  So, here are a few of my Dad favorites:


  1. That thing above your head is more than just a hat rack.  I went through several hat phases (some more flattering than others), but this wasn’t a knock on the hats.  At least I never thought it was until right now.  ANYWAYS... the purpose of the phrase is pretty simple.  Use your brain.  It’s a useful tool.  
  2. It builds character.  I went into heavy detail on this one in THIS ARTICLE for Indie Minded.  Basic gist-- setbacks are an opportunity for growth.
  3. No chewing gum.  This wasn’t really a phrase. Just a general life rule.  One that had me pumped to leave for college where I could finally chew gum 24 hours a day like I’d always dreamed.  Then I went to college and realized that was a silly dream.  Anyways, this rule was not about oral health as much as it was about how you choose to present yourself to the world.  If you show up smacking Bubblicious, you are pretty much shouting "I don't care," and therefore, repelling everybody in sight.  This applies to you as a person, and also to your work.  Pull it together.  Spit out the gum.  Present your best self.  
  4. Slim or None.  The odds of me getting to do something stupid and/or harmful that I wanted to do growing up.  Once those activities were rightfully weeded out, I was left with learning, playing, reading, music, sports, laughing, exploring, imagining, writing, and anything else that was positive and creative.  Thanks Dad.
  5. Sleep is the best medicine-  Here here!!!  Let’s put an end to the “I got no sleep last night because I’m a busy bee who works harder than everyone else” badge of honor.  To anyone who proudly shoves this into the faces of those who value health and function, I kindly request that you shut up and get some rest.  You look tired.
